Transaction 9052fb786295385f84a1eea82938fbb52a6711bd26b1735af18468b53a179c5c

2 Input
2 Outputs
  • 9052fb786295385f84a1eea82938fbb52a6711bd26b1735af18468b53a179c5c:0
  • value  23441
    address  15FFGibGXn3yaLNmnH8mrCHcrBnxDsnVUs
  • 9052fb786295385f84a1eea82938fbb52a6711bd26b1735af18468b53a179c5c:1
  • value  6756875
    address  16z1nWRJDcbgDzyQFY62Q37gGHG2duWvKS